Make a Difference. Be the Fresh Start in Sunbury-On-Thames.

* Do you have experience working with students with SEND or SEMH needs?
* Are you able to deliver education in creative and engaging ways?
* Are you looking for a rewarding role working 1:1 with young people who need your help?

At Fresh Start in Education, we’re looking for proactive, person-centred individuals to design and deliver personalised learning sessions that spark curiosity, confidence, and hope for young people with SEN or SEMH needs. Whether exploring Maths during a trip to the shops, unlocking imagination through stories and art, or using gaming to explore Science, you’ll inspire students to rediscover the joy of learning tailored to their interests.

If you have the experience, empathy, and commitment to transform lives and are seeking a flexible role that allows you to meet students’ needs effectively, we would love to hear from you.


The Placements

* Working with students on a 1:1 or 2:1 basis in their home or a suitable venue around Sunbury-On-Thames.
* Planning, delivering, or supporting 2-5 sessions weekly, each lasting 3-5 hours during school hours and term-time.
* Placements organized and supported by our dedicated teams.
* Bank Staff roles providing short-term provisions, paid via PAYE.


Requirements to Apply

* Minimum of 2 years’ professional experience working with vulnerable children or young people with additional needs (SEN, SEMH, or other barriers).
* Experience delivering or supporting numeracy, literacy, and communication skills in creative, practical, and engaging ways.
* Availability to commit to at least 2 sessions per week (minimum of 2 working days).
* Practical, up-to-date safeguarding knowledge and a commitment to safety.


Benefits

* Competitive hourly rate of £25 to £35.
* Subsidised travel costs and £15 per day for resources.
* Free wellbeing and counseling services, pension options, and store discounts.
* Opportunity to work with a nationally recognized provider of specialist support for vulnerable children and young adults.

We are a leading provider of alternative education in the UK, supporting vulnerable populations for over a decade. Our dedicated staff make a lasting impact, helping shape brighter futures. Join us to make a difference. Contact us at 020 3409 6410.

All roles require thorough background checks, including ID, Right to Work, employment verification, and an enhanced DBS.
